Transaction eb173438324fab5eb597f0c51c18028b74fd9bc999519aff8e171d416183e574

1 Input
2 Outputs
  • eb173438324fab5eb597f0c51c18028b74fd9bc999519aff8e171d416183e574:0
  • value  439370
    address  1EpwL3m6AsbwVntVTkLuo91hG6ss4K9aqQ
  • eb173438324fab5eb597f0c51c18028b74fd9bc999519aff8e171d416183e574:1
  • value  1075987
    address  34aMRk4JDbgzLz8mC3hvnVLHYgoTdn3psE